Requirements:
  • 10+ years of experience in a creative leadership role, preferably within the licensing and consumer products industry.
  • Exceptional design skills with pro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ite and other relevant design software.
  • Strong project management abilities, including the capacity to prioritize tasks, meet deadlines, and manage resources effectively.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ate across departments and influence stakeholders at all levels.
  • A strategic mindset with a deep understanding of market trends, consumer behavior, and brand positioning.
  • Proven experience to manage studios (film, series or game) in the creation of product development
  • Gaming experience preferred
Responsibilities:
  • Team management and experience coaching.
  • Detailed understanding of the product development processes, production, and manufacturing.
  • Lead the planning and development of style guides, creative assets, PD tools, and serving as the primary driver behind the creation process.
  • Collaborate with external agencies to source talent and manage the execution of creative projects, ensuring alignment with brand standards and objectives.
  • Generate mock-ups, product applications, and mood boards that effectively communicate key trends and concepts to internal teams and external partners.
  • Guide creative collaboration thro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Lead all stages of product development across all categories for any licensing deal or collaborations.
  • Undertake general design tasks to support Licensing team’s efforts, including but not limited to branding, packaging, promotional and marketing collateral trade show needs, and sales materials.
